Case 1
Use the diagnostic statement in this case note to answer the following questions using the ICD-10-CM Code Book.
Clinic Note This 57-year-old female patient comes to the clinic today. HEENT: Normal LUNGS: Clear ABDOMEN: Soft, nontender RECTAL EXAM: Refused NEUROLOGICAL: Congenital spastic paralysis, left leg
There are no physical findings that need to be addressed at this time. I have reviewed her care plan, and she should continue per her care plan at the residential home where she resides.
Hints:
- Main term: The condition, check the Alphabetic Index for which term is bold.
- Sub term: Check first vertical line indented under the main term for terms that describe the main term (condition).
- Remember to that only the left leg is affected, which is monoplegia.
What is the main term that leads to the ICD-10-CM code for congenital spastic paralysis?
Which ICD-10-CM diagnosis code should be assigned for congenital spastic paralysis of the left leg?
